Operation Kaveri would see IndiGo operate flights from Jeddah to Delhi and Bengaluru

On Friday, IndiGo said that it will run chartered flights from Jeddah to Bengaluru and the nation's capital in order to transport Indians who had been evacuated from Sudan as part of Operation Kaveri home.

Over the weekend, the airline will run two flights to return more than 450 Indian citizens to their country of origin.

On April 28 and 30, these flights will be run using A321 aircraft. From Jeddah in Saudi Arabia, they will be run to Delhi and Bengaluru.

According to the statement, “IndiGo is closely coordinating with the government to offer support for more such evacuation flights.”

India transported 754 individuals from the violently divided Sudan back on Friday as part of Operation Kaveri.

According to government statistics, there have already been 1,360 Indians returned to their home countries.
